
According to his office statement, the aggressive type of prostate cancer was diagnosed by former US President Joe Biden. Last week, Biden was admitted to the Philadelphia hospital, where doctors identified a “small node” on their prostate, which required further evaluation.
The 82 -year -old former president dealt with symptoms of urine, his office reported on Sunday.
What are the symptoms of prostate cancer?
According to the World Health Organization report (WHO), prostate cancer usually first causes symptoms simply by reducing the flow of urine, leading to poor current, dribbing and need to pass urine several times during the night.
“There may also be blood in the urine. Benign prostate enlargement is, of course, very common and causes the same symptoms. The only ways to distinguish each other are biopsy and dog,” he added.
In more advanced cases, prostate cancer can spread (metastasize) to bones or lymph nodes, causing: bone pain (especially in sides, back or thighs), inexplicable weight loss and fatigue.
How much Biden’s cancer has spread?
According to Kelly Scully, the cancer has spread to bones – the development observed about 60% of advanced cases of prostate cancer based on zero prostate cancer data.
Scully also noted that Biden’s cancer had Gleason’s score 9, suggesting a highly aggressive form of disease. The Gleason score is used to measure, as is likely that prostate cancer has to grow and spread, a score of 9 signals rapidly growing and potentially more dangerous cancer.
Treatment
“Although it represents a more aggressive form of the disease, the cancer seems to be sensitive to hormones, allowing effective treatment,” Scully said, as Bloomberg says. “The President and his family review the treatment options with their doctors.”

Since its cancer is sensitive to hormones, it can still respond to hormonal therapy that works by blocking the production or effect of testosterone-terrible hormone for prostate cancer growth, reports in the report.
For advanced prostate cancer, treatment options usually include hormonal therapy, chemotherapy, radiation or a combination of these approaches. Hormonal therapy can help manage the disease and alleviate symptoms, while chemotherapy is generally considered when cancer is aggressive or no longer responds to hormone -based treatment.

Since withdrawal from the office, Biden has largely remained outside the public eyes and spoke only after the first 100 days of President Donald Trump. With the upcoming publishing of his book, however, he began to appear in more interviews, including programs such as ABC’s The View, where – even in the usually favorable environment – faced questions about his age.

Cancer was a deeply personal problem for biden. In 2015, his son Beau died after fighting brain cancer. During his work, Biden led the “Cancer Mooonshot” initiative, which advocated greater investments in cancer research and efforts to accelerate the search for drugs, Bloomberg reported.
